Bundle Your Benefits In One (Medicare Part C)

Medicare Advantage plans, also called Medicare Part C, are an all-in-one alternative to Original Medicare. These plans are offered by private companies approved by Medicare, so you’ll want to use doctors and other health care providers who participate with the plan. Medicare Advantage plans bundle Medicare Part A (hospital insurance), Part B (medical insurance) and usually Part D (drug coverage) into one plan. Most Medicare Advantage plans offer coverage for things Original Medicare doesn’t cover, like some vision, dental, hearing, gym memberships, over-the-counter drugs, and more.

Buy Your Benefits A La Carte

If you choose to stay with Original Medicare (Part A – Hospital, and Part B – Medical), you can add on a Medicare Part D prescription drug plan and a Medicare Supplement (also known as Medigap).

Medicare Part D

Medicare Part D helps pay for the prescription drugs you need. To get Medicare drug coverage, you must join a Medicare-approved plan that offers drug coverage. Each plan can vary in cost, pharmacies you can use, and specific drugs covered. There are two ways to get Medicare drug coverage:  

  • A Medicare drug plan – A plan that only covers prescription drugs.  
  • A Medicare Advantage Plan – An all-inclusive health care plan that combines your hospital, medical, and prescription coverage into one plan (see above).

Medicare Supplement (Medigap)

A Medigap policy (also called Medicare Supplement Insurance) is private health insurance that’s designed to supplement Original Medicare. This means it helps pay for some of the health care costs that Original Medicare doesn’t cover, like copayments, coinsurance, and deductibles. If you have Original Medicare and a Medigap policy, Medicare will pay its share of the Medicare-approved amounts for covered health care costs. Then your Medigap policy pays its share.
